What Makes an Online Casino Trustworthy?
A credible casino should clearly identify its operating company, licensing authority, customer support channels, and responsible gambling tools. Licensing does not guarantee a perfect experience, yet it establishes enforceable standards for security, game integrity, identity verification, and complaint handling.
Look for a visible licence number that can be checked on the regulator’s official website. The operator should also publish terms in readable language rather than hiding essential restrictions inside dense promotional pages. Secure encryption, multi-factor account protection, and reputable payment processors are additional indicators of mature operations.
- Confirm the licence and registered company details.
- Review withdrawal rules before depositing.
- Check whether games come from established software providers.
- Test support response times with a basic question.
- Locate deposit limits, self-exclusion, and cooling-off controls.
Games, Software, and Fairness
Game variety matters, but catalogue size should not be the only deciding factor. A balanced lobby may include slots, live dealer tables, roulette, blackjack, poker, and progressive jackpots. More important is whether titles come from recognised studios that use independently tested random number generators.
Return to player, or RTP, indicates the theoretical percentage returned to players over a very long period. It is not a promise for an individual session. Volatility describes how frequently and dramatically a game may pay. Players seeking steadier outcomes may prefer lower-volatility titles, while those comfortable with larger swings may consider high-volatility games.

Bonuses: Value Depends on the Terms
A welcome bonus can increase entertainment value, but the headline amount rarely tells the full story. Analyse the wagering requirement, eligible games, maximum bet, expiry period, minimum deposit, contribution rates, and maximum cash-out rule. A bonus with a high advertised value may be less useful than a smaller offer with flexible conditions.
For example, a bonus of £100 with 30x wagering on deposit plus bonus requires £6,000 in qualifying play before withdrawal. If slots contribute 100% but blackjack contributes only 10%, the practical cost of using the promotion changes substantially. Read the current terms immediately before claiming because campaigns can change without notice.
Deposits, Withdrawals, and Customer Support
Payment convenience is a commercial advantage, but speed should be assessed alongside verification requirements. Card payments, bank transfers, e-wallets, and selected instant methods may differ in fees, processing times, and availability by jurisdiction. A reputable casino explains pending periods and does not create unnecessary obstacles after a legitimate withdrawal request.
Identity checks are normal, particularly before a first withdrawal. Prepare accurate documentation and ensure account details match the payment method. Avoid operators that request unusual transfers, encourage repeated deposits to unlock withdrawals, or provide vague answers about transaction status.
- Use a payment method registered in your own name.
- Check minimum and maximum transaction limits.
- Confirm whether processing or currency-conversion fees apply.
- Save confirmation emails and transaction references.
Managing Risk and Making a Final Choice
Casino games are entertainment products, not income strategies. Set a fixed budget, establish a time limit, and never chase losses. Deposit limits, reality checks, session reminders, temporary breaks, and self-exclusion can create useful barriers when play becomes difficult to control.
Before registering, compare at least three operators using the same criteria: legal status, game quality, bonus conditions, payment performance, support, and safety tools. Start with a modest deposit, avoid overlapping promotions, and withdraw funds according to your own budget rather than increasing stakes after a losing session.
The best online casino is not necessarily the one with the largest bonus or longest game list. It is the operator that demonstrates verifiable regulation, clear commercial terms, dependable payments, fair games, and meaningful player controls. A structured comparison gives you a stronger basis for choosing where to play and when to walk away.
